So far, we’ve been looking outward, this week we are looking inward.

According to Reader’s Digest:

 

Although relationships are one of the best antidotes to stress, sometimes you need time alone to recharge and reflect. 

When you travel on an airplane, they always stress one safety precaution that makes me smile.  They tell passengers traveling with babies and young children that in the event of an emergency, put the oxygen mask on yourself first, than on the child.

This is safety advice for life! How can we take care of everyone else, if we are falling apart? Put your oxygen mask on yourself!

 

WEEK 4

This week we are focusing on spending time alone.

Take a walk, read a magazine, go out to lunch by yourself or have coffee in your car alone, even if it’s just parked outside your house! The time doesn’t matter, whether it’s 15 minutes or 2 hours. Just make time for yourself, alone.
